WebThe Busey family name was found in the USA, the UK, Canada, and Scotland between 1840 and 1920. The most Busey families were found in USA in 1880. In 1840 there were 4 Busey families living in Maryland. This was about 19% of all the recorded Busey's in USA. Maryland had the highest population of Busey families in 1840. Bussey Name Meaning. English (of Norman origin): habitational name from any of several places in Normandy, France: Boucé in Orne, from which came Robert de Buci mentioned in Domesday Book, Bouce (Manche), or Bucy-le-Long (Aisne).
